Israel Meir

President, Technology at Altisource

Israel Meir began their work experience in 1990 as the Founder and General Manager of LeadingTone Software, Inc. Israel went on to work at Polaroid as a Senior Principal Engineer from 1992 to 2000. In 2000, Meir became the Director of Software Products at Aether Systems until 2002. From 2003 to 2008, they served as the Head Teaching Fellow at Harvard University. In 2008, Meir joined The Boston Consulting Group as a Principal, a role they held until 2014. Since 2014, they have been working at Altisource, where they have held various executive positions including Chief Operating Officer, President of Technology Services, and currently serves as the Chief Strategy and Technology Officer (CSTO) and Executive Vice President (EVP).

Israel Meir obtained a Bachelor of Liberal Arts degree in Natural Science from Harvard University.
